What is the average MOT pass rate for a Rolls Royce Ghost V12?
The Rolls Royce Ghost V12 has an average 93.8% MOT pass rate across model years 2010 to 2012, based on DVSA test data.
What are the most common MOT failures on a Rolls Royce Ghost V12?
The most common MOT failure reasons for the Rolls Royce Ghost V12 across all years are: a tyre seriously damaged, a tyre cords visible or damaged, number plate does not conform to the specified requirements. These are typical wear items that can often be checked and addressed before your test.
